Olympic body waiting
for BAP-SBP papers

The country's new basketball group, Basketball Association of the Philippines-Samahang Basketball ng Pilipinas, has not yet submitted its application for membership to the Philippine Olympic Committee, three days after the International Basketball Federation announced that it is ready to lift the country's suspension, POC first vice-president and Rep. Monico Puentevella said yesterday.

Puentevella, chairman of the membership committee, said the POC needs 10 days to scrutinize the papers related to the BAP-SBP's application for membership.

The BAP-SBP will then present the papers in the POC general assembly on Feb. 15, before a special meeting will be held on the next day to discuss their membership, he said.

The new cage body only needs the recognition of the POC to pave the way for the lifting of the suspension slapped by the International Basketball Federation close to two years ago.*CPT
